Potato Pete

One of the characters that encouraged people to eat potatoes during the war, was Potato Pete; and, he (and his recipes) appear in many of my WWII cookbooks and recipes leaflets.

Celebrate "VE Day" with Potato Pete and an Authentic WWII Recipe: "Whit Salad" (3)

Potatoes weren’t just healthy, with research showing children get more Vitamin C, B1, B6, Folate, Iron, Magnesium and Potassium from potatoes than from the 5 super-foods; beetroot, bananas, nuts, broccoli and avocado combined, but they weren’t rationed and being home-grown, they saved the fleet, insofar as there was no need to ship them from overseas to Great Britain.

Wartime Potatoes & Eggs

Now, I have already made Woolton Pie, and several other 1940’s potato recipes, so it was time to do some research for less well-known potato dishes that were on the healthy side too.

I finally discovered the recipe I wanted to replicate in the Victory Cookbook by Marguerite Patten; this fabulous publication is a compilation of three of her wartime recipe books, “We’ll Eat Again”, “The Victory Cookbook” and the“Post-War Kitchen”.

It’s a nostalgic cookbook covering war-time rationing, food and recipes and is a wonderful resource of period recipes, as well as facsimiles, cartoons and photos from the era.

Celebrate "VE Day" with Potato Pete and an Authentic WWII Recipe: "Whit Salad" (6)

My recipe was featured in the “snacks and supper dishes” chapter and it intrigued me so much I had to make it. As eggs were heavily rationed during the war, so the recipe sets out to replicate them as mock eggs, in a rather brilliant way, as you can see from the photos, and at the same time make good use of the humble spud.

What Is Whit Salad?

The salad is very impressive to look at and is VERY filling, as we found to our cost, with no bread needed to accompany it.

It was fun to make and very tasty, with a selection of cooked potatoes and raw vegetables on the platter.

Celebrate "VE Day" with Potato Pete and an Authentic WWII Recipe: "Whit Salad" (7)

A simple “salad cream” style dressing is made for the salad, and I worked out that each portion was about 300 calories per person, which is remarkably low for such a tasty and filling salad.

The original recipe says it feeds 4 people, but I’d say that it would feed 5 to 6 people with ease.

Whit Salad Recipe

WW2 Whit Salad (Mock Egg Salad with Potatoes and Vegetables)

Print recipe

Serves 4 to 6
Prep time 15 minutes
Allergy Milk
Dietary Vegetarian
Meal type Lunch, Main Dish, Salad
Misc Child Friendly, Pre-preparable, Serve Cold
Occasion Birthday Party, Casual Party, Christmas, Easter, Formal Party
Region British
From book Victory Cookbook by Marguerite Patten

An authentic WW2 salad recipe where the eggs (which were rationed) are made with carrot, a little cheese and mashed potatoes! This salad looks very attractive and feeds four people with ease. Potatoes, that were home-grown, are put to good use in this salad recipe, which is very healthy due to many raw vegetables. The name "Whit Salad" is thought to be derived from Whitsun, which is an important holiday in the church calendar and was celebrated as a public holiday with picnics, fêtes, galas, walks, dances and church suppers.

Ingredients

Mock potato eggs

  • 225g grated carrots
  • 50g grated Mature Cheddar cheese
  • 450g cooked mashed potatoes (Desiree)

Salad

  • 450g cooked, diced potatoes (Charlotte or Maris Peer)
  • 1/2 small cabbage, grated (or celeriac)
  • 2 - 3 carrots, grated
  • baby gem lettuce leaves
  • 12 small (cherry) tomatoes, halved
  • fresh chives, snipped

Salad dressing

  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• pinch of white pepper
  • 1 teacup of milk (about 120mls)
  • 1 tablespoon vinegar
  • 1/2 teaspoon English mustard powder
  • 1 teaspoon sugar

Directions

Step 1 To make the potato eggs, mix the grated carrots and cheese together to form balls, like egg yolks; add a little of the mashed potato to bind them if necessary. Wrap the balls with a layer of mashed potato, and then cut in half, so they resemble hard boiled eggs.
Step 2 Arrange the salad ingredients on a large serving platter - lettuce first and then the carrots, cabbage (or celeriac), diced potatoes with snipped chives; arrange the tomatoes and mock egg halves around the outside of the salad.
Step 3 Make the dressing by whisking all the ingredients together and drizzle over the salad.
Step 4 NB: Any root vegetables can be used in place of the cabbage and carrots, and commercially made salad cream can be used too. When watercress is in season, decorate the salad with watercress.
